About the job

Help make Graphcore hardware feel native inside the ML frameworks engineers use every day.

As a Software Engineer in our PyTorch team, you will help build the software that connects Graphcore accelerators with state-of-the-art machine learning frameworks. You will design, implement, optimise and support features across PyTorch, Triton and related technologies.

Your work will help ML engineers and researchers get more from Graphcore hardware, without changing how they want to build. That means better compatibility, stronger performance and cleaner developer experiences.

You will contribute to upstream PyTorch, support our hybrid Python and C++ extension, and help integrate compiler backend capabilities with torch.compile. You will learn fast, solve real engineering problems and build expertise in a large open-source ecosystem.

The team and culture

You will join the PyTorch team within Frameworks, working in a SCRUM team that ships features, reviews code, writes documentation and supports users. Work happens through clear ownership, practical decisions and close communication across software, AI/ML, research and hardware teams.

The team values maintainable code, thoughtful design and curiosity about unfamiliar systems. Engineers are trusted to investigate, speak up and improve the codebase as they learn.

This is a team for people who like open-source communities, complex technical problems and visible impact. You will move quickly, but with care for users and long-term quality.

Join the team at Graphcore

Graphcore is one of the world’s leading innovators in Artificial Intelligence compute. It is developing hardware, software and systems infrastructure that will unlock the next generation of AI breakthroughs and power the widespread adoption of AI solutions across every industry.

As part of the SoftBank Group, Graphcore is a member of an elite family of companies responsible for some of the world’s most transformative technologies. Together, they share a bold vision: to enable Artificial Super Intelligence and ensure its benefits are accessible to everyone.

Graphcore’s teams are drawn from diverse backgrounds and bring a broad range of skills and perspectives. A melting pot of AI research specialists, silicon designers, software engineers and systems architects, Graphcore brings together deep expertise to solve complex problems and deliver meaningful progress in AI compute.
